Abstract. For experiments like HAGAR, based on atmospheric Cherenkov technique, performance of the experiment depends strongly on the level of night sky background (NSB) at the observation site. Proper modeling of NSB in simulations is important to get the realistic estimate of the performance parameters. Here we present the Monte Carlo simulation of NSB and its comparison with experimental data. Effect of after-pulsing in photo-multiplier tubes is also modeled in present simulations.
